How do the six kingdoms fit into the three domains?
The domain Bacteria has the kingdom Eubacteria, while the domain Archaea, contains the kingdom Archaebacteria. These two domains contain single-celled prokaryotes. On the other hand, all eukaryotes are placed under the domain Eukarya. These eukaryotes include kingdoms Protista, Fungi, Plantae, and Animalia.

What are the 7 levels of classification of kingdoms?
The seven levels of taxonomy from broadest to most specific are: Kingdom. Phylum. Class. Order. Family. Genus. Species.

Why six kingdom classification?
Archaebacteria and Eubacteria are both unicellular prokaryotic cells found in the environment. But, Archaebacteria have some specialized adaptation that helps them in surviving the harsh environment. Eubacteria are considered true bacteria. Therefore, there is now a six-kingdom classification.

Are there 5 or 7 kingdoms of life?
The 5 kingdoms of life are Animalia, Plantae, Fungi, Protista, and Monera. When there are 6 kingdoms, Monera breaks into Eubacteria and Archaebacteria. In biology, a kingdom of life is a taxonomy rank that is below domain and above phylum.
